Compounding Pharmacies: Specifying Medication to Unique Needs
Compounding pharmacies offer a personalized service that goes beyond simply dispensing pre-made medications. They have the ability to create customized drug formulations adjusted to meet the precise needs of each patient. This can be particularly helpful for individuals who have trouble swallowing traditional pills, need alternative dosage forms like creams or liquids, or require medications with specific ingredients not readily available in standard drug preparations.
Compounding pharmacies work closely with patients and their doctors to understand their personal requirements. They utilize advanced equipment and techniques to ensure the safety, efficacy, and exactness of each compounded medication.

Understanding Active Pharmaceutical Ingredients (APIs)
Active Pharmaceutical Ingredients also known as APIs are the essential components of a medication. These compounds are credited with producing the therapeutic effect sought. APIs are meticulously formulated and regulated to ensure both efficacy and potency. Understanding the properties and functions of APIs is vital for researchers, manufacturers, and healthcare professionals alike.

Pharmaceutical Compounding and its Role
Compounders play a essential role in the healthcare landscape. They are highly skilled professionals who synthesize customized medications specific to meet the unique requirements of patients. Compounding can be vital in situations where mass-produced medications are ineffective. A compounder's expertise allows them to adjust medications based on considerations including allergies, reactions, and patient preferences.
- Furthermore, compounders often prepare medications in non-traditional forms like creams, gels, or suppositories to improve patient compliance.
